Entry Requirements

  • A completed Advanced Diploma or equivalent Level 5 energy qualification
  • Alternatively, 3+ years of supervisory petroleum, energy or renewables experience with a portfolio statement
  • IELTS 6.0 or equivalent English proficiency for international applicants
  • Two academic or professional references
  • Interview with the LSPE admissions team
